Channel 5’s My Wife, My Abuser: Captured on Camera tells the story of a man named Richard Spencer who was abused physically, mentally, and financially by his wife, Sheree Spencer. What makes this story more harrowing and more like a lived-in experience is the real footage of the abuse that was captured on camera.

Where to stream My Wife, My Abuser: Captured on Camera?

Although My Wife, My Abuser: Captured on Camera is a Channel 5 production, it was dropped on the platform in 2024. The two-part series is also available to stream on Netflix. However, both these options apply only to the UK. The docuseries is not available for the US audience on Netflix.
The US audience might use a VPN to stream the documentary on Netflix, or they might buy or rent it on Plex. Notably, the docuseries is also available on Amazon Prime Video and Apple TV, but availability varies from region to region. The best possible route is to use a VPN to gain access to the Netflix UK library or the Apple TV catalogue.
The two-part series chronicles Richard Spencer's two decades of ongoing emotional and physical abuse at the hands of his wife, Sheree Spencer, which the outside world was totally unaware of. In addition to footage from the nanny cams, written testimonies, audio recordings, and images, the documentary includes interviews with Richard, who has chosen to share his story in an effort to increase awareness about male victims of domestic abuse.

The fate of Sheree Spencer
After being apprehended, Sheree Spencer entered a guilty plea to three counts of assault resulting in actual bodily harm as well as coercive and controlling behavior. In March 2023, Hull Crown Court sentenced her to four years in prison. She was found guilty of crimes that occurred between 2016 and 2021.

What is more saddening is that there were kids involved. Richard Spencer shares three children with Sheree, and he later praised their courage throughout the ordeal. Through his interviews in the documentary, viewers are faced with a stereotype-breaking truth that men can also be on the other side of domestic violence.
